Output 3aa80507c52a083df9ba9d869f0326a7b8e0d98395d71f64ae6ff354fddd5eda:24

value
3750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666ad6cb3a8d4bee9b37b59d1063898a2d7a61ec OP_EQUAL
address
3B2YqR91uuYdT1MikhCMggbeGHysXsxp5m
transaction
3aa80507c52a083df9ba9d869f0326a7b8e0d98395d71f64ae6ff354fddd5eda
spent
true